Hi :)

It isn't hard at all :). Start off with a topic that you're passionate about. This makes doing research, which is usually the hardest part, easier and more enjoyable. Once you have a topic, find three subtopics. You ultimately conclude with a summary of all that you've learned. I always say write with contradiction: Your paper needs to be fluid and yet concrete int he way you organize your thoughts. Readers want facts and not necessarily your opinion. That also gives your writing credibility. Good Luck!!
